Psalms 78:71
from tending the ewes He brought him to be shepherd of His people Jacob, of Israel His inheritance.
BSB
Parallel translations (2) ▾
ASV
From following the ewes that have their young he brought him, To be the shepherd of Jacob his people, and Israel his inheritance.
KJV
From following the ewes great with young he brought him to feed Jacob his people, and Israel his inheritance.
